TRANSFORMED TO PERFECTION
Secure a rare prize in one of Seatoun´s most desirable tree lined streets. With a sweeping frontage this landmark home is surrounded by extensively landscaped gardens.
Over the last two years 46 Inglis Street has had an innovative reinvention, designed by award winning architects Studio Pacific. The home offers outstanding accommodation with a versatile floor plan on a 736m2 site.
The timeless facade gives no hint of the distinguished family residence extended and renovated behind. The second living room that adjoins the dining area and kitchen is the show stopper, where a seamless indoor/outdoor flow has been created. Large doors open onto the west facing garden which has its own wonderful micro climate.
All day sun spills through into the superbly equipped kitchen that serves as much in style as it does in function. The character panelling, floors and ceilings have been enhanced with modern touches. A full master suite, study, central heating, gas fire and double garage are among just a few of its many features.
